Whoopi Goldberg Says Travis Kelce Faces 'Double Standard' Amid Taylor Swift Proposal Speculation
Travis Kelce could make history on Feb. 9 with his team, the Kansas City Chiefs, if they win the Super Bowl for the third year in a row.
But despite his monumental achievement, the NFL player has been fielding seemingly as many questions about his private life as his professional one this week, with speculation swirling that he could soon ask his girlfriend, Taylor Swift, to marry him.
On Feb. 3 during the Super Bowl’s opening night event, Kelce was asked if he plans to propose to the pop superstar, prompting him to reply with a smile and a coy “Wouldn’t you like to know?”
Panelists on The View discussed the topic on the Feb. 8 episode of the morning show, giving their take on the matter. Whoopi Goldberg took issue with the relationship questions that Kelce has been getting, rising to his defense.
“As if the Chiefs' Travis Kelce doesn’t have enough on his mind right now, he was asked whether he was going to propose to Taylor Swift. He’s playing his game!” the Ghost star exclaimed. “It’s his day! Can’t he have his daggone day?!” she said before throwing to a series of clips where reporters asked Kelce about Swift, from her acting like a good-luck charm for the team to her cooking skills.
“It seems to be a bit of a double standard when it comes to asking men personal questions, because some questions just feel invasive. I know everybody wants to know, but this is, as he’s said, this is the biggest game of his life,” continued Goldberg. “If he does it, let it be a surprise to everybody.”
Sunny Hostin then chimed in to say that she thinks “it’s great that they’re together. They’re obviously in love, I believe in true love, y’all know that. But this is about the sport, this is about his game. Why are all the questions about Taylor Swift and what kind of food she makes for him?”
“Let the man bask in his moment. He made it to the Super Bowl for the third time, that’s a big deal!” proclaimed Hostin.
Ana Navarro quipped that while she’d love to know more about Swift’s famous homemade Pop-Tarts, she’s wondering “why he has to propose to her. Why couldn’t she propose to him? We are in 2025, she could be on that Jumbotron with a sign, ‘Travis Kelce, will you marry me?’”
Her fellow panelists laughed at her idea, but Navarro parried back, saying, “Give me some grace! There’s two of them!”
